It will be challenging. Just between February 2003 and October 2005 alone, there were 221 cases of sexual misconduct. Impunity was often the outcome. The U.N. peacekeepers are immune from local laws. Some countries don't even have sexual assault laws.

Lhasa's historic heart, around the sacred Jokhang temple, was swarming with paramilitary officers and regular police Friday. At least two paramilitary men, in camouflage uniforms, were posted at every alley and street corner in the old town.

Canada has apologised for forcing more than 100,000 aboriginal children to attend state-funded Christian boarding schools aimed at assimilating them.

"The entire Darfur region is a crime scene," the Prosecutor of the International Criminal Court told the Security Council this morning, adding that "Impunity reigns."

UNITED NATIONS experts on child rights have criticised the United States for detaining juveniles at Guantanamo, in Afghanistan and in Iraq, and voiced concern that some may have suffered cruel treatment.
